Past President of the National Speakers Association Mike McKinley always
says, "Do not worry about minor mistakes when you are public speaking. The
audience does not know your script."
If you have lots of good material, it will make very little difference in the
big scheme of things if you forget to mention something you had planned to say
during your public speaking engagement. Such an omission
wouldn't make a BIG difference. Thus, it
isn't worth getting yourself so rattled because you left something out that you start a domino effect
of making additional mistakes and omissions.
